Trait ArrayType

Source
pub trait ArrayType {
    const DATA_TYPE: DataType;
}

Required Associated Constants§

Dyn Compatibility§

This trait is not dyn compatible.

In older versions of Rust, dyn compatibility was called "object safety", so this trait is not object safe.

Implementors§

Source§

impl ArrayType for Boolean

Source§

const DATA_TYPE: DataType = DataType::Boolean

Source§

impl ArrayType for Boundary

Source§

const DATA_TYPE: DataType = DataType::Boundary

Source§

impl ArrayType for Color

Source§

const DATA_TYPE: DataType = DataType::Color

Source§

impl ArrayType for FreeformSubblock

Source§

const DATA_TYPE: DataType = DataType::FreeformSubblock

Source§

impl ArrayType for Gradient

Source§

const DATA_TYPE: DataType = DataType::Gradient

Source§

impl ArrayType for Image

Source§

const DATA_TYPE: DataType = DataType::Image

Source§

impl ArrayType for Index

Source§

const DATA_TYPE: DataType = DataType::Index

Source§

impl ArrayType for Name

Source§

const DATA_TYPE: DataType = DataType::Name

Source§

impl ArrayType for Number

Source§

const DATA_TYPE: DataType = DataType::Number

Source§

impl ArrayType for RegularSubblock

Source§

const DATA_TYPE: DataType = DataType::RegularSubblock

Source§

impl ArrayType for Scalar

Source§

const DATA_TYPE: DataType = DataType::Scalar

Source§

impl ArrayType for Segment

Source§

const DATA_TYPE: DataType = DataType::Segment

Source§

impl ArrayType for Texcoord

Source§

const DATA_TYPE: DataType = DataType::Texcoord

Source§

impl ArrayType for Text

Source§

const DATA_TYPE: DataType = DataType::Text

Source§

impl ArrayType for Triangle

Source§

const DATA_TYPE: DataType = DataType::Triangle

Source§

impl ArrayType for Vector

Source§

const DATA_TYPE: DataType = DataType::Vector

Source§

impl ArrayType for Vertex

Source§

const DATA_TYPE: DataType = DataType::Vertex